PLpro Binding with 12 Compounds,The papain-like protease (PLpro), a component of the large, multi-domain protein NSP3, is a cysteine protease essential for the replication of coronaviruses and thus a potential target for antivirals. This chapter confirms a binding site consisting of .-helices 5 and 8 and the strands 1, 2, 3, 4, and 7 of .-sheet-4 of PLpro monomer.
